Buck Meek – announces headline show at Whelans, Dublin

Returning with his band for the first time since Summer 2023, having toured extensively across North America, East Asia and Australia, Meek brings his compelling live show to UK and European venues, including London’s EartH Theatre on 20 March 2026.

Meek released his stunning third solo album, Haunted Mountain, in August 2023. The album featured songs co-written with one of Buck’s long-time musical heroes Jolie Holland and gained universal acclaim from the likes of Rolling Stone, Uncut, MOJO and more
